Senior Project Architect, Healthcare
Little Diversified Architectural Consulting
| Little, nationally recognized as a “Best Firm to Work For” and one of the nation’s most progressive design firms, is seeking a Senior Project Architect with a passion impacting lives, for high quality healthcare design and a positive, collaborative work style, for our expanding Healthcare Studio in our Orlando, FL Office.
If you’re a healthcare architect looking for meaningful work and a team that values your voice and expertise, this is the place to grow. At Little, you’ll work across a spectrum of healthcare projects that impact lives and contribute to a healthy, collaborative team. Together, we advance healthcare design in thoughtful and responsible ways that elevate care environments.
A candidate we’ll love:
A position you’ll love:
|
Ideal candidates will possess the following qualifications: - 10+ years in Architecture with substantial Acute Healthcare Experience, including at least 4 years with AHCA-regulated projects. - Architectural license required - Bachelor’s degree or higher in Architecture from an accredited program - Excellent communication and documentation skills - Strong proficiency in relevant software: Autodesk Revit, Microsoft Products, Newforma, Bluebeam - Thorough knowledge of architectural design, detailing, building system, including engineering and medical equipment coordination - Thorough understanding of FGI Guidelines, Building Codes, and industry standards - Ability to travel Why Little: Little is a place where you’ll surround yourself with colleagues who have different areas of expertise, are from different cultures and generations, and embody different talents, experiences and passions.
